"""
|
|
This module contains tests for verifying the completeness and correctness of translations in the project.
|
|
|
|
It ensures that:
|
|
1. All log messages in the code have corresponding translations
|
|
2. All translations in the YAML files are actually used in the code
|
|
3. No obsolete translations exist in the YAML files
|
|
|
|
The tests work by:
|
|
1. Extracting all translatable messages from Python source files
|
|
2. Loading translations from YAML files
|
|
3. Comparing the extracted messages with translations
|
|
4. Verifying no unused translations exist
|
|
"""

def _extract_log_messages(file_path:str, exclude_debug:bool = False) -> MessageDict:
|
|
"""
|
|
Extract all translatable messages from a Python file with their function context.
|
|
|
|
Args:
|
|
file_path: Path to the Python file to analyze
|
|
|
|
Returns:
|
|
Dictionary mapping function names to their messages
|
|
"""
|
|
with open(file_path, "r", encoding = "utf-8") as file:
|
|
tree = ast.parse(file.read(), filename = file_path)
|
|
|
|
# Add parent references for context tracking
|
|
for parent in ast.walk(tree):
|
|
for child in ast.iter_child_nodes(parent):
|
|
setattr(child, "_parent", parent)
|
|
|
|
messages:MessageDict = defaultdict(lambda: defaultdict(set))
|
|
|
|
def add_message(function:str, msg:str) -> None:
|
|
"""Add a message to the messages dictionary."""
|
|
if function not in messages:
|
|
messages[function] = defaultdict(set)
|
|
if msg not in messages[function]:
|
|
messages[function][msg] = {msg}
|
|
|
|
def extract_string_value(node:ast.AST) -> str | None:
|
|
"""Safely extract string value from an AST node."""
|
|
if isinstance(node, ast.Constant):
|
|
value = getattr(node, "value", None)
|
|
return value if isinstance(value, str) else None
|
|
return None
|
|
|
|
for node in ast.walk(tree):
|
|
if not isinstance(node, ast.Call):
|
|
continue
|
|
|
|
function_name = _get_function_name(node)
|
|
|
|
# Extract messages from various call types
|
|
if (isinstance(node.func, ast.Attribute) and
|
|
isinstance(node.func.value, ast.Name) and
|
|
node.func.value.id in {"LOG", "logger", "logging"} and
|
|
node.func.attr in {None if exclude_debug else "debug", "info", "warning", "error", "exception", "critical"}):
|
|
if node.args:
|
|
msg = extract_string_value(node.args[0])
|
|
if msg:
|
|
add_message(function_name, msg)
|
|
|
|
# Handle gettext calls
|
|
elif ((isinstance(node.func, ast.Name) and node.func.id == "_") or
|
|
(isinstance(node.func, ast.Attribute) and node.func.attr == "gettext")):
|
|
if node.args:
|
|
msg = extract_string_value(node.args[0])
|
|
if msg:
|
|
add_message(function_name, msg)
|
|
|
|
# Handle other translatable function calls
|
|
elif isinstance(node.func, ast.Name) and node.func.id in {"ainput", "pluralize", "ensure"}:
|
|
arg_index = 0 if node.func.id == "ainput" else 1
|
|
if len(node.args) > arg_index:
|
|
msg = extract_string_value(node.args[arg_index])
|
|
if msg:
|
|
add_message(function_name, msg)
|
|
|
|
print(f"Messages: {messages}")
|
|
|
|
return messages
